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

При подписании ошибка Api error: http://crl.pki.gov.kz/d_rsa.crl #54

Closed
Zhangirkhan opened this issue Sep 28, 2020 · 10 comments

Comments

@Zhangirkhan
Copy link

При подписании с 1 первой версии выходит ошибка
Api error: http://crl.pki.gov.kz/d_rsa.crl
по ссылке такого файла нет. Можете ли вы обратиться в Национальный удостоверящей центр Республики Казахстан
чтобы исправить эту ошибку. Благодарен.
если что в файле ncanode.ini думаю можно убрать ссылку на этот файл? или я не прав

@Zhangirkhan
Copy link
Author

В конечном итоге остались вот эти вот документы
;; Список урлов для скачивания CRL. URL необходимо разделять пробелами.
crl_urls=http://crl.pki.gov.kz/nca_rsa.crl http://crl.pki.gov.kz/nca_gost.crl http://crl.pki.gov.kz/nca_d_rsa.crl http://crl.pki.gov.kz/nca_d_gost.crl

@DimaSavchenko
Copy link

@Zhangirkhan @malikzh есть новости?
запрос из примера не отрабатывает https://ncanode.kz/docs.php?go=9797704344e3175efb3260fbc5e58dac6c2fed3d

{ "message": "Api error: http://crl.pki.gov.kz/rsa.crl", "status": 5 }

@blumfontein
Copy link

Добрый день, та же проблема. При иницализации докер контейнера в логах такая ошибка:

9/29/2020 5:01:34 PMDownloading CRL from: http://crl.pki.gov.kz/rsa.crl ...
9/29/2020 5:01:34 PMjava.io.FileNotFoundException: http://crl.pki.gov.kz/rsa.crl
9/29/2020 5:01:34 PM at sun.net.www.protocol.http.HttpURLConnection.getInputStream0(HttpURLConnection.java:1890)
9/29/2020 5:01:34 PM at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1492)
9/29/2020 5:01:34 PM at java.net.URL.openStream(URL.java:1045)
9/29/2020 5:01:34 PM at org.apache.commons.io.FileUtils.copyURLToFile(FileUtils.java:1456)
9/29/2020 5:01:34 PM at kz.ncanode.pki.CrlServiceProvider.downloadCrl(CrlServiceProvider.java:167)
9/29/2020 5:01:34 PM at kz.ncanode.pki.CrlServiceProvider.updateCache(CrlServiceProvider.java:125)
9/29/2020 5:01:34 PM at kz.ncanode.pki.CrlServiceProvider.(CrlServiceProvider.java:34)
9/29/2020 5:01:34 PM at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
9/29/2020 5:01:34 PM at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
9/29/2020 5:01:34 PM at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
9/29/2020 5:01:34 PM at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
9/29/2020 5:01:34 PM at kz.ncanode.ioc.ServiceContainer.createInstance(ServiceContainer.java:104)
9/29/2020 5:01:34 PM at kz.ncanode.ioc.ServiceContainer.resolveDependencies(ServiceContainer.java:113)
9/29/2020 5:01:34 PM at kz.ncanode.ioc.ServiceContainer.createInstance(ServiceContainer.java:83)
9/29/2020 5:01:34 PM at kz.ncanode.ioc.ServiceContainer.resolveDependencies(ServiceContainer.java:113)
9/29/2020 5:01:34 PM at kz.ncanode.ioc.ServiceContainer.createInstance(ServiceContainer.java:83)
9/29/2020 5:01:34 PM at kz.ncanode.ioc.ServiceContainer.boot(ServiceContainer.java:70)
9/29/2020 5:01:34 PM at kz.ncanode.Launcher.main(Launcher.java:70)

malikzh added a commit that referenced this issue Sep 29, 2020
@malikzh
Copy link
Owner

malikzh commented Sep 29, 2020

Здравствуйте, @Zhangirkhan @DimaSavchenko . Да эти файлы были удалены на сервере. Я создал коммит с исправлением этой ошибки. Сейчас только 4 crl используется я их оставил, остальные убрал.

malikzh added a commit that referenced this issue Sep 29, 2020
Исправление ошибки #54
@malikzh
Copy link
Owner

malikzh commented Sep 29, 2020

Релиз собирается: https://github.com/malikzh/NCANode/releases/tag/v2.0.2

@malikzh
Copy link
Owner

malikzh commented Sep 29, 2020

Новый релиз выпущен: https://github.com/malikzh/NCANode/releases/tag/v2.0.2
Ошибку устранил. Благодарю за обратную связь.

@malikzh malikzh closed this as completed Sep 29, 2020
@blumfontein
Copy link

Докер образ вы не собираете?

@malikzh
Copy link
Owner

malikzh commented Sep 29, 2020

@blumfontein который для билда нет, а который для запуска Dockerfile.run он скачивает последнюю версию с гитхаба. А вообще такая задача имеется чтобы Travis ещё и образ деплоил, потому что мне не нравится, что у нас два докерфайла)

@malikzh
Copy link
Owner

malikzh commented Sep 29, 2020

Иными словами если Вы перезагрузите контейнер:

docker stop ncanode
docker rm ncanode
docker run ncanode ...

то должна новая версия развернуться.

@blumfontein
Copy link

Спасибо разобрались

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ants